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
921 328 29 67007195 501
32 632984994
32 632984994
9074075 642252072 55815727351 156913677 39
All about undefined
Interested in learning more?
32 632984994
9074075 642252072 55815727351 156913677 39
See more
1721 6456920 5494
05 54904539 552
See more
801397389 15867103 49506389578
076665391 430 1308861165
See more